Pine Bluff Man Faces $10,000 Bond for Theft Allegation

By Ray King

A $10,000 bond was set Monday for a Pine Bluff man on a theft allegation.

Jefferson County District Judge Kim Bridgforth set the bond after ruling prosecutors have probable cause to charge Jamar Johnson, 42, with breaking or entering and theft of property.

Deputy Prosecutor Shana Alexander said on Friday, police were sent to 3101 S. Iris St.

Johnson was told to come back to court Aug. 25.
